From 1bb8c53ed308d5806963f297018b2e114d516888 Mon Sep 17 00:00:00 2001 From: Jasper Abbink Date: Fri, 15 Aug 2025 12:00:06 +0200 Subject: [PATCH] feat(NU.nl): Support latest app version (#5643) --- .../main/kotlin/app/revanced/patches/nunl/ads/HideAdsPatch.kt | 2 +- patches/src/main/kotlin/app/revanced/patches/nunl/ads/Hooks.kt |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/patches/src/main/kotlin/app/revanced/patches/nunl/ads/HideAdsPatch.kt b/patches/src/main/kotlin/app/revanced/patches/nunl/ads/HideAdsPatch.kt index 7aef3b3b9..14d05cfbc 100644 --- a/patches/src/main/kotlin/app/revanced/patches/nunl/ads/HideAdsPatch.kt +++ b/patches/src/main/kotlin/app/revanced/patches/nunl/ads/HideAdsPatch.kt @@ -14,7 +14,7 @@ val hideAdsPatch = bytecodePatch( name = "Hide ads", description = "Hide ads and sponsored articles in list pages and remove pre-roll ads on videos.", ) { - compatibleWith("nl.sanomamedia.android.nu"("11.3.0")) + compatibleWith("nl.sanomamedia.android.nu") dependsOn(sharedExtensionPatch("nunl", mainActivityOnCreateHook)) diff --git a/patches/src/main/kotlin/app/revanced/patches/nunl/ads/Hooks.kt b/patches/src/main/kotlin/app/revanced/patches/nunl/ads/Hooks.kt index 9a2e28bca..e83d37322 100644 --- a/patches/src/main/kotlin/app/revanced/patches/nunl/ads/Hooks.kt +++ b/patches/src/main/kotlin/app/revanced/patches/nunl/ads/Hooks.kt @@ -4,6 +4,6 @@ import app.revanced.patches.shared.misc.extension.extensionHook internal val mainActivityOnCreateHook = extensionHook { custom { method, classDef -> - classDef.type == "Lnl/sanomamedia/android/nu/main/NUMainActivity;" && method.name == "onCreate" + classDef.endsWith("/NUApplication;") && method.name == "onCreate" } }